  • Publication number: 20050218029
    Abstract: An insert system for transforming a transport container into a habitable structure. The system includes panels that are inserted into an existing container, wherein an insulating cavity remains between the container and the inert panels. The cavity provides efficient environmental control.

  • Patent number: 6742664
    Abstract: Construction system for providing load support in the transportation of goods in containers having a floor and a ceiling. The system includes at least one supporting beam and at least two telescopic bar organs, each having a first end disposed on the floor of the container and a second end expandable to the ceiling of the container, pressing thereby against the floor and the ceiling. The bar organs extend through the at least one supporting beam at end areas, and include a plurality of longitudinally disposed holes for locking a bar organ to a supporting beam at a predetermined height by means of a latch pin.

  • Patent number: 6331090
    Abstract: Device for establishing a gastight and fluidtight connection in a horizontal level between two or more containers (100, 200) of the iso-container type. The device includes a substantially band shaped, elastic sealing member (300) which surrounds an opening (20) between the containers to be connected and which is arranged on a supporting surface (105). A pressure exerting member (130) is provided to hold the sealing member (300) tightly against the supporting surface (105) with tightening members (400) to force the sealing member (300) against the supporting surface (105). The sealing member (300) in mounted position is arranged with a generally rectangular cross section and is placed against a supporting surface (105) on the respective containers, generally extending in the main level of the respective containers. The pressure exerting member constitutes at least four generally band shaped members (130) arranged at the respective flat supporting surfaces (105) of a container (100).

  • Patent number: 6164476
    Abstract: Collapsible container comprising a bottom element (11) with openings (21) at the corners for disengagable attachment of two opposite gable walls (12, 13). The gable walls are connected to or are associated with supporting pillars (24) which are provided with slit shaped openings (31) for disengagable mounting of longitudinally arranged sidewall elements (14, 15) which have projecting hooks (28, 29) with notches (30) for engagement with the slit-shaped openings. Openings (39-44) are arranged in the bottom element (11) for disengagable attachment of a transversal partition wall (36). The sidewall elements (14, 15) each have a height dimension (A) which is one half of the width of the bottom element (11). The distance (B) between two sidewall elements (14, 15) is less than the depth of the notch (30) in the hooks (28, 29). The corner posts (22) of the gable walls (12, 13) are manufactured with a tubular profile with attachment slit openings (31) facing inwards, for attachment of shelves (33).

  • Patent number: 6102228
    Abstract: A device for connecting two or more ISO type containers (101, 102). A support (401, 451) is arranged at each container (101a, 102a) to encircle an equivalent aperture (10) of each container to establish a land surface (402, 452) facing the internal cavity of each respective container (101a and 102a). The sealing means (201) establishes a continuous sealing extending from said first land surface (402) of said first container (101a), across the aperture (10) between the containers and to said second land surface (452) of the second container (102a), and along the entire perimeter of the aperture (10) between the containers, and being retained sealingly to said land surfaces (402, 452) by a first and second frame-shaped clamping means (301 and 351). The respective clamping means (301, 351) presses the underlying sealing means (201) towards their respective land surfaces fy fastening means.
